From the Organizer

Age-Graded 4-Miler is held every July 4th to celebrate Independence Day and the club's founding. It differs from other races. Runners start at a time determined by their gender and age. The goal is for everyone to finish close to one another.

The winner is the first person to physically cross the finish line, regardless of chip time.

The race uses specialized handicap tables based on age-group records.

The results will show the runners' chip times.

This event is part of the DCRRC's Bunion Derby Series; for more information/rules, visit the race series rules page.

Registration closes at 8:00 p.m. the night before the race. Park Service rules prohibit registration on race day.
